What to Expect from the Experience

Booking this transfer means you’ll be covered from the moment you check out of your Sydney hotel until you arrive at the cruise terminal. The process is straightforward: after confirming your booking, you’ll receive clear instructions about your pickup time, which is usually within a flexible window. You’ll need to provide details like your cruise ship name, docking, and boarding times, helping your driver plan accordingly.

On the day, a professional driver will meet you at your hotel, assist with your luggage, and then take you directly to your cruise port. For groups of one to three, you’ll ride in a sleek, luxury sedan that provides a cozy and private environment. For larger groups, a spacious minivan is used, ensuring everyone has a comfortable seat. Drivers tend to be helpful and polite, and some reviews mention additional info about Sydney’s sights along the way—little touches that can make the ride more pleasant.

The journey itself is brief — typically between 15 and 45 minutes — but that small window is significant for your peace of mind. Knowing that your transfer is pre-arranged and private means you won’t be waiting around or dealing with uncertain taxi lines on the day of your cruise.

FAQ

Sydney Port Private Departure Transfer: City Hotel to Cruise Port - FAQ

Can I cancel this transfer if my plans change?
Yes, you can cancel for free up to 24 hours before your scheduled pick-up time. Cancellations made less than 24 hours in advance won’t be refunded.

What if I have more than one suitcase?
You are allowed one suitcase and one carry-on bag per traveler. If you have oversized or excess luggage, it’s best to inquire with the operator beforehand.

Will the driver meet me at my hotel?
Yes, the driver will meet you at your city hotel, assist with your luggage, and take you directly to the cruise port.

Is this service available 24/7?
Yes, pickup is available from 6:00 AM to 10:30 PM daily, and an emergency contact number is provided for any issues.

How long does the transfer typically take?
The journey usually lasts between 15 and 45 minutes, depending on traffic and your hotel’s location.

What vehicles are used?
Small groups of one to three are transported in luxury sedans, while larger groups are accommodated in spacious minivans.

Are drivers knowledgeable about Sydney?
Many reviews mention drivers who share helpful information about the city, which can make the ride more engaging.

What’s included in the price?
The fee covers a private vehicle, hotel pickup, a 15-minute waiting time, and port drop-off.

Are there any hidden charges?
Excess luggage charges may apply if you have oversized items. Additional services, like return transfers, are not included.
